Hyperkalemia is a medical condition characterized by abnormally high levels of potassium in the bloodstream. Potassium is an essential electrolyte that plays a vital role in maintaining normal nerve function, muscle contraction, and the electrical activity of the heart. Under normal circumstances, the kidneys regulate potassium levels by removing excess amounts from the body.

When this balance is disrupted and serum potassium levels rise above 5.0 mmol/L, it can interfere with the body's electrical signaling, particularly affecting the heart and muscles. If left untreated, hyperkalemia may lead to serious complications, including life-threatening cardiac arrhythmias. Early diagnosis and appropriate treatment are essential to restore potassium balance and prevent adverse outcomes.

What Causes Hyperkalemia?

The causes of hyperkalemia are multifaceted, often involving complex interactions between dietary intake, renal function, and cellular dynamics. Understanding these causes is critical for effective hyperkalemia management.

Renal Insufficiency

The kidneys play a pivotal role in regulating potassium levels by excreting excess potassium in urine. Renal insufficiency or failure impairs this function, leading to the accumulation of potassium in the bloodstream. Chronic kidney disease is, therefore, a primary risk factor for hyperkalemia.

Medications

Certain medications can contribute to hyperkalemia by altering renal function or cellular potassium distribution. These include:

  • ACE inhibitors and ARBs: Commonly prescribed for hypertension and heart failure, these drugs can decrease renal potassium excretion.
  • Potassium-sparing diuretics: These diuretics prevent potassium loss, which, if not monitored carefully, might result in elevated serum potassium levels.

Cellular Shift

Conditions that cause a shift of potassium from the intracellular to the extracellular space can also cause hyperkalemia. Metabolic acidosis, tissue breakdown (such as from trauma or burns), and certain hemolytic conditions can lead to this shift.

Excessive Potassium Intake

While rare, excessive dietary potassium intake can exacerbate hyperkalemia, especially in individuals with compromised kidney function.

How is Hyperkalemia Diagnosed?

Diagnosis of hyperkalemia involves a combination of clinical evaluation and laboratory tests.

Blood Tests

A serum potassium test is the definitive method for diagnosing hyperkalemia. Blood tests may also assess kidney function and electrolyte balance to identify underlying causes.

Electrocardiogram (ECG)

An ECG can detect cardiac manifestations of hyperkalemia, such as peaked T waves, widened QRS complexes, and other conduction abnormalities.


How is Hyperkalemia Treated?

The treatment of hyperkalemia depends on the severity of the condition and the presence of symptoms.

Mild Hyperkalemia

  • Dietary modifications: Reducing potassium intake may suffice for mild cases.
  • Medication review: Adjusting or discontinuing medications that contribute to high potassium levels.

Moderate to Severe Hyperkalemia

  • Intravenous calcium: Calcium can stabilize cardiac cells and counteract the effects of high potassium on the heart.
  • Insulin and glucose infusion: This combination helps shift potassium back into cells, temporarily lowering blood levels.
  • Diuretics: Loop diuretics may be used to increase renal potassium excretion.

Emergency Interventions

In life-threatening situations, treatments such as dialysis or the administration of sodium polystyrene sulfonate may be necessary to reduce potassium levels rapidly.

How Can Hyperkalemia Be Prevented?

Preventing hyperkalemia involves managing underlying conditions and avoiding triggers.

Dietary Management

  • Limit potassium-rich foods: Individuals at risk should limit foods like bananas, oranges, and potatoes.
  • Monitor salt substitutes: Some salt substitutes contain potassium chloride, which can contribute to elevated potassium levels.

Medication Management

Regular monitoring and adjustment of medications that affect potassium balance are critical in preventing hyperkalemia. Healthcare providers may need to adjust dosages or switch medications to mitigate risk.

Regular Monitoring

Regular blood tests to monitor potassium levels can help prevent hyperkalemia in patients with chronic kidney disease or other predisposing conditions.
